Viana do Castelo lies on the mouth of the Rio Lima river in in the Minho province of northern ccr16,Portugal, about 30km south of the Spanish border. Viana do Castelo is surrounded by hills, and one of the best places to view the area from is the top of the dome of Santa Luzia Church. One of the highlights of the year is the Festas de Nossa Senhora de Agonia in late August.

Viana was founded by King Afonso III of Portugal in 1253 and has always had a close association with the sea. During the 15th Century a large number of Jews migrated to Viana, fleeing persecution in Spain. The city was for a while plagued with pirate raids and grew as an important departure point for various Portuguese exploration voyages. It was from here that adventurers like João Velho departed to chart the Congo. The port today is still active, with a thriving fishing industry and various tours available both along the Lima River and the coastline.

One of the highlights of visiting Vaina do Castelo is Praça da República, a central square surrounded by the unique, arcaded Igreja da Misericórdia building and the 16th Century 'Paço do Concelho', the old town hall. Within the square is the 15th Century Chafariz fountain. Also within the town is the 'Castelo de Santiago do Barro', the castle from which Viana derives the second part of it's name. It was built in the 16th Century to protect the town and port from pirates, and holds a market on the parapets on Fridays.

Various beaches stretch north of Viana, almost to the Spanish border, providing miles of unspoilt and relatively undeveloped coastline to explore and relax in. The city is surrounded by beautiful countryside, full of small, traditional villages, occasional working water mills, isolated chapels and waterfalls.

TRAVEL DIRECTIONS AND GETTING THERE

Viana do Castelo lies near to the IC1 road in Portugal, 31 km south of the Spanish border, 25km north of Esposende and 75km north of Porto. It is 26km west of Ponte de Lima (A27) and 57km northwest of Braga (IC14, IC1).
